Abstract
We introduce the notion of the probability weighted characteristic function (PWCF) as a generalization of the characteristic function. Some of the properties of the PWCF and of its empirical counterpart are studied and the potential use of these quantities in goodness-of-fit testing is examined in detail. The corresponding limiting null distributions and consistency results for location-scale models are derived and finite-sample comparisons are presented. Also, the notion of the PWCF is extended to arbitrary dimension.
